Output 5fcc4f440c0c9962b9d484f28768d98ae393e3f3163ac2f3c2dd2ba4a845455e:42

value
40902906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d3481920e31e79a836ecae6eef7ff7280b4f18 OP_EQUAL
address
3JuS4iKCW58TTzsbJ1GViuTefSj9jLnV1a
transaction
5fcc4f440c0c9962b9d484f28768d98ae393e3f3163ac2f3c2dd2ba4a845455e
confirmations
177296
spent
true